Overview House of Doom 2: The Crypt

If you like things that bump in the night and enjoy the thrill of being scared out of your wits, then Play ‘n GO might have the perfect game for you. House of Doom 2: The Crypt, is about as spooky as online slot games get, without turning into fully-fledged horror films. You might have come across this game’s prequel, the original in the series called (unsurprisingly) House of Doom. Play ‘n GO had a real success with that game and have come back with a fresher, more feature-heavy version, that promises to be even better.

House of Doom 2: The Crypt is especially exciting as it comes with 3 terrifying game zones. The zone that you play in makes a real difference to the features which will come your way, of which there are many. They include wilds, an excellent free spins round, transforming wilds, as well as multipliers up to 10x!

Theme and Symbols

Play ‘n GO has taken the previous theme of gothic nightmares and just increased the intensity and detail by about 20%. Although they have made quite a few changes, Play ‘n GO has made sure to keep the core of the aesthetic similar to the previous game, which was inspired by the song “House of Doom” written by the epically hardcore metal band, Candlemass. The board, background and symbols all connote death, evil, and various terrifying creatures, designed to frighten the weak of heart. Especially impactful are the solemn crypt keeper statues which flank the screen to the left and right of the board.

When it comes to the symbols, Play ‘n GO has made sure to take full creative license with their design and make sure they are as creepy as possible. Regular symbols are conventional playing card letters and numbers, dyed the deep red colour of blood. Accompanying them are a collection of appropriately murderous icons including a spooky melting candle, a brace of daggers arranged in a cross, and a haunting dying flower. As interesting as these might be, they are not nearly as shocking or important as the skull with spikes jutting out of its forehead, this is the most valuable symbol in the game. There are also three different wild symbols, which trigger the special Crypt Spins bonus features.

Game Play

This slot from hell is played on a standard 5-reel 3-row board, with 20 ways to win. The base game is played on this board, where players must match the nefarious symbols in winning formations from left to right.
The game really kicks into gear though when players collect Crypt Wilds, opening up a whole world of extra modifiers, re-spins and free spins, which accelerate the player’s earning potential.

The betting range for House of Doom 2: The Crypt is between 20p and £100 per spin. Unlike quite a proportion of Play ‘n GO’s flagship slots, the volatility isn’t too high. The game creators have given it a 7 out of 10 rating, which puts it in the high region but only just. The return to player for House of Doom 2: The Crypt is ever so slightly better than average, coming in at 96.25%. There is no official hit frequency stat for this slot. The top prize is a hefty 6,000x your stake.

Features

The first set of features players need to be aware of are the ‘Spirit Gate’ features. When you are playing the base game, you might be lucky enough to be introduced to the ‘Spirit Gate’ which places itself in a random position on the reels.
If you manage to land a wild in this gate, it will expand to fill the whole of the reel. Following this, the special Spirit Gate re-spin feature plays out with one of three special modifiers. The type of wild that you land in the gate, dictates the feature which will then follow. These are described below:

The Queen of the Damned feature: If you land a Queen of the Damned wild in the special Spirit Gate, extra spirit gates are deposited onto the reels for the re-spin. This means a greater chance of landing yet more expanding wilds and building a bigger score.

The Fire Mistress feature: If a Fire Mistress wild lands inside the Spirit Gate, a random multiplier is applied to any win which is created if you win on the following re-spin. These can range from 2x to a massive 10x.

The Metal Priestess feature: This haunting looking wild when it lands in the Spirit Gate transforms symbols during the re-spin, metamorphosising the low-value Ritual Relic symbols into the premium Spiky Skull symbol.

The next main bonus feature is the Free Spins feature, which is a little more conventional in its style and application. To trigger the Free Spins round, all players need to do is land a Crypt scatter symbol on reels 1, 2 and 5 on the same spin.
You will then be given free spins and a chance to add more Spirit Gates to the reels. Land a wild in the Spirit gate when within the free spins and you’ll trigger the associated modifier which is then added to the already heightened gameplay. This means the potential of having expanding wilds, multipliers, and high-value Skulls all at the same time.

Lastly, there are the special Crypt Spins. This is probably the best and most lucrative feature, so we saved it until last. To trigger this feature, players must land 3 of the flaming Crypt scatters whilst the free spins is still in effect.
This will give you 8 free Crypt Spins. Landing a Spirit of Unity wild in the Spirit Gate from within this feature, rewards a very special, almost unbelievable re-spin which has all three Spirit Gate modifiers active on the spin. With all these features working as one, the payout and a visual feast are stunning.

Frequently Asked Questions House of Doom 2: The Crypt

What is the top win available for this game?

The max win for this game is 6,000x your stake. This beats the previous game’s max win, which was 2,500x your stake.

What is the RTP of House of Doom 2: The Crypt?

The return to player percentage for House of Doom 2: The Crypt is a respectable 96.26% which again is an improvement on the previous game’s 96.10%.

Is House of Doom 2: The Crypt available to play on mobile devices?

You can play House of Doom 2: The Crypt on tablets, smartphones and desktop computers as it is mobile compatible.

What software developer created House of Doom 2: The Crypt?

Play ‘n GO is the studio that has created this excellent game.

How many pay lines are there available for House of Doom 2: The Crypt?

There are 20 available pay lines for this game.
